If you refuse to blow into the machine – or you repeatedly fail to provide a sufficient sample – then you can actually be charged with the offence of ‘refusing to provide a sample’. This can be punished by up to six months’ imprisonment and a driving disqualification.

In this scenario, a defendant was stopped for driving under the influence of alcohol and was administered a breathalyzer test on the scene. At trial, the prosecution sought to admit written records of the maintenance procedures on the breathalyzer equipment to prove that the breathalyzer worked properly.
WebBreathalyzer Testing Procedures. In conducting an Intox EC/IR or Intoxilyzer 5000 breath test, law enforcement must abide by pre-established testing protocol. Before the test, you must be advised that you are allowed to have a witness present. If you choose to exercise this right, the test administrator must wait 30 minutes to allow the witness ...
